The Chemical Reaction That Causes Rust - ThoughtCo

WebThe iron reacts with water and oxygen to form hydrated iron(III) oxide, which we see as rust. Iron Oxide can be classified into sixteen types and the most well-known one is rust (type of iron (iii) … injecting fake tanIron oxides feature as ferrous (Fe(II)) or ferric (Fe(III)) or both. They adopt octahedral or tetrahedral coordination geometry. Only a few oxides are significant at the earth's surface, particularly wüstite, magnetite, and hematite. Oxides of Fe Mixed oxides of Fe and Fe Oxide of Fe See more Iron oxides are chemical compounds composed of iron and oxygen. Several iron oxides are recognized. All are black magnetic solids. Often they are non-stoichiometric.
